Types Of Thermometer In Physics See The Most Used Thermometers Pdf A thermometer is calibrated by using two objects of known temperatures. the typical process involves using the freezing point and the boiling point of pure water. Any physical property that depends consistently and reproducibly on temperature can be used as the basis of a thermometer. for example, volume increases with temperature for most substances. this property is the basis for the common alcohol thermometer and the original mercury thermometers.

A thermometer is a device that measures temperature or a temperature gradient (the degree of hotness or coldness of an object). it consists of two parts: a means to measure temperature (e.g., mercury) and a means to convert that temperature into a readable output.
